File: patch-ids.c Progetto: 9b/git
/*
 * When we cannot load the full patch-id for both commits for whatever
 * reason, the function returns -1 (i.e. return error(...)). Despite
 * the "cmp" in the name of this function, the caller only cares about
 * the return value being zero (a and b are equivalent) or non-zero (a
 * and b are different), and returning non-zero would keep both in the
 * result, even if they actually were equivalent, in order to err on
 * the side of safety.  The actual value being negative does not have
 * any significance; only that it is non-zero matters.
 */
static int patch_id_cmp(struct patch_id *a,
			struct patch_id *b,
			struct diff_options *opt)
{
	if (is_null_sha1(a->patch_id) &&
	    commit_patch_id(a->commit, opt, a->patch_id, 0))
		return error("Could not get patch ID for %s",
			oid_to_hex(&a->commit->object.oid));
	if (is_null_sha1(b->patch_id) &&
	    commit_patch_id(b->commit, opt, b->patch_id, 0))
		return error("Could not get patch ID for %s",
			oid_to_hex(&b->commit->object.oid));
	return hashcmp(a->patch_id, b->patch_id);
}

/*
 * When we cannot load the full patch-id for both commits for whatever
 * reason, the function returns -1 (i.e. return error(...)). Despite
 * the "neq" in the name of this function, the caller only cares about
 * the return value being zero (a and b are equivalent) or non-zero (a
 * and b are different), and returning non-zero would keep both in the
 * result, even if they actually were equivalent, in order to err on
 * the side of safety.  The actual value being negative does not have
 * any significance; only that it is non-zero matters.
 */
static int patch_id_neq(const void *cmpfn_data,
			const void *entry,
			const void *entry_or_key,
			const void *unused_keydata)
{
	/* NEEDSWORK: const correctness? */
	struct diff_options *opt = (void *)cmpfn_data;
	struct patch_id *a = (void *)entry;
	struct patch_id *b = (void *)entry_or_key;

	if (is_null_oid(&a->patch_id) &&
	    commit_patch_id(a->commit, opt, &a->patch_id, 0))
		return error("Could not get patch ID for %s",
			oid_to_hex(&a->commit->object.oid));
	if (is_null_oid(&b->patch_id) &&
	    commit_patch_id(b->commit, opt, &b->patch_id, 0))
		return error("Could not get patch ID for %s",
			oid_to_hex(&b->commit->object.oid));
	return !oideq(&a->patch_id, &b->patch_id);
}

File: log.c Progetto: 136357477/git
static void prepare_bases(struct base_tree_info *bases,
			  struct commit *base,
			  struct commit **list,
			  int total)
{
	struct commit *commit;
	struct rev_info revs;
	struct diff_options diffopt;
	int i;

	if (!base)
		return;

	diff_setup(&diffopt);
	DIFF_OPT_SET(&diffopt, RECURSIVE);
	diff_setup_done(&diffopt);

	oidcpy(&bases->base_commit, &base->object.oid);

	init_revisions(&revs, NULL);
	revs.max_parents = 1;
	revs.topo_order = 1;
	for (i = 0; i < total; i++) {
		list[i]->object.flags &= ~UNINTERESTING;
		add_pending_object(&revs, &list[i]->object, "rev_list");
		list[i]->util = (void *)1;
	}
	base->object.flags |= UNINTERESTING;
	add_pending_object(&revs, &base->object, "base");

	if (prepare_revision_walk(&revs))
		die(_("revision walk setup failed"));
	/*
	 * Traverse the commits list, get prerequisite patch ids
	 * and stuff them in bases structure.
	 */
	while ((commit = get_revision(&revs)) != NULL) {
		unsigned char sha1[20];
		struct object_id *patch_id;
		if (commit->util)
			continue;
		if (commit_patch_id(commit, &diffopt, sha1))
			die(_("cannot get patch id"));
		ALLOC_GROW(bases->patch_id, bases->nr_patch_id + 1, bases->alloc_patch_id);
		patch_id = bases->patch_id + bases->nr_patch_id;
		hashcpy(patch_id->hash, sha1);
		bases->nr_patch_id++;
	}
}
